In twrp. Do you have a file on your phone or want to put one on it? If you hAve no os and you want to put one on it to flash look below. If you just don't know how to flash click install and its self explanatory.
Now plug your phone into a computer with adb and working g2 drivers. It's the same process. Installing twrp with option 2 to push the file. You should or probably push it to /storage/emulated/0 this is the sd card. From here you can install it with twrp. If you took shortcuts to install root and twrp and don't have adb working there's a search on Google for that as well.
